Transaction cdf176adc294204438fe690447cbb5c9f5163818e5f6e32c8c45b254eb608c8e

2 Input
2 Outputs
  • cdf176adc294204438fe690447cbb5c9f5163818e5f6e32c8c45b254eb608c8e:0
  • value  16380245
    address  moLEJ8ByBrmFTyuZYuArEsdUSqzA16KPDc
  • cdf176adc294204438fe690447cbb5c9f5163818e5f6e32c8c45b254eb608c8e:1
  • value  100000000000
    address  mox8cRwV7D1nd6dSFGMK8bsh5D4D8o3giS